In this The Mindful Journey episode, host Sana sits down with Dr. Dean Howell—developer of NeuroCranial Restructuring (NCR)—and Rebecca, his partner in research and wellness. Together, they explore how cranial alignment and biochemistry impact brain performance, emotions, and healing.

The conversation challenges conventional medicine and opens a thought-provoking dialogue about skull alignment, fluid dynamics in the brain, emotional trauma, and how lifestyle choices influence long-term health. Dr. Howell and Rebecca share personal stories and decades of experience that may shift how you think about both the structure and chemistry of the body.

This is not just about how the brain works—but how it works best.

About the Guests

Dr. Dean Howell is a naturopath and creator of NeuroCranial Restructuring, a technique designed to optimize skull alignment and brain function. With nearly 50 years of experience, he has worked with patients worldwide to address chronic conditions through structural and biochemical optimization.

Rebecca brings her lived experience of healing from arthritis and multiple cancers into their joint practice. Together, they emphasize a holistic approach that blends cranial work, biochemistry, emotional release, and lifestyle guidance.
